The study was headed by Dr. Charles Elder of the Kaiser Permanente Center for Health Research located in Portland, Oregon. The study consisted of 472 obese adults (having BMIs ranging from 30 to 50) and over age thirty. Among the participants 83% were women and one quarter were seniors over the age of 65. Participants were enrolled in a weight loss program that had included group counseling, maintaining a food diary, moderate exercise (most each day having a minimum of three hours each week) decreasing daily calorie intake by 500 and maintaining a low-fat, low-salt diet which was high in vegetables , fruits, whole grains and lean proteins.
Researchers had observed particular lifestyle measures such as stress levels, nightly sleep quality and depression. This was done at the start of the study and six months later.
During the study period, 60% of the participants had lost a minimum of ten pounds. Researchers had discovered that factors such as exercise and maintaining a food journal along with behavioral counseling sessions were associated to weight loss. On average the participants had lost around fourteen pounds.
Researchers also discovered some significant indicators for success which were sleep quality and stress. Among the participants those who had noted sleeping less than six hours but no more than eight hours each night at the beginning of the study, had a greater chance to achieve the ten pound weight loss goal in comparison to those sleeping six to eight hours each night.
Stress complicated that link, those who slept to little or too much and noted high stress levels had only a 50% chance of making it to the second phase of study in comparison to those who had got six to eight hours of sleep and had low stress levels. Weight loss was linked to decreased stress levels. Researchers suggest that those who are trying to lose weight should concentrate on obtaining quality sleep and decrease stress.
